Well i picked up the chilli bin on tuesday
it was the big appointment at the f clinic

man am i glad i took my backpack - i was not carrying that up the street
it needed to be kept refridgereated - full of needles and syringes and bottles of stuff
no way was i taking it to work so after stuffing it in my bag, i walked to my friends shop and used her fridge for the day

i had had my visit to the fertility clinic and learned how to inject myself - i practised on a sponge

i start for real tomorrow morning

eeeekkkk

aside from hating needles
it all feels so real

annoying that i have to do this darn it being so hard for me
and so darn easy for others

but im glad the day is finally here
